20150238597 | CARBOHYDRATE-GLYCOLIPID CONJUGATE VACCINES - The present invention relates to the field of synthesizing and biologically evaluating of a novel class of carbohydrate-based vaccines. The new vaccines consist of a multi-modular structure which allows applying the vaccine to a whole variety of pathogenes. This method allows preparing vaccines against all pathogens expressing immunogenic carbohydrate antigens. As conjugation of antigenic carbohydrates to proteins is not required the conjugate vaccine is particularly heat stable. No refrigeration is required, a major drawback of protein-based vaccines. | 2015-08-27 |

20150238599 | NONSPECIFIC IMMUNOSTIMULATOR COMPOSITION, METHOD OF PREPARATION THE SAME, AND ITS USE - Disclosed are a nonspecific immunostimulant composition, a preparation method thereof, and uses thereof. The composition includes 150 to 300 wt. parts of sodium silicate, 2˜8 wt. parts of sodium thiosulfate, 0.5˜2 wt. parts of sodium carbonate, 0.5˜2 wt. parts of potassium chloride, 200˜400 wt. parts of white sugar, and 300˜400 wt. parts of water, based on 100 wt. parts of potassium carbonate. The composition exhibits excellent defense against the mortality caused by AIV H5N1, thus improving the survival of infected animals. As a supplement of a formulated feed mixture for farmed aquatic organisms, the composition provides excellent immunostimulation and disease resistance so as to decrease the mass mortality of aquatic organisms and to increase productivity. Particularly, when raised with a food in mixture with the composition, livestock and farmed aquatic organisms are immunologically improved so that they can endure and are protected against epidemic diseases caused by viruses and bacteria. | 2015-08-27 |

20150238642 | Method and System to Clean Microorganisms without Chemicals - A system for removing microorganisms from a surface is described. The system includes a conducting member, a voltage source, and an electrostatic field controller. The conducing member includes a nonwoven material incorporating conductive fibers. The controller is electrically connected to the conducting member and is configured to apply a DC voltage of about 15 volts or less to the conducting member via the voltage source. The surface to be contacted can include any surface present in households, food industry facilities, medical facilities, etc. Such surfaces can include tables, countertops, walls, cabinets, doors, door handles, door knobs, etc. The system can also be used to treat devices used in the aforementioned environments, such as food preparation equipment, medical devices, household appliances, etc. The system can reduce the amount of microorganisms on the surface by at least about 1 log (90%) without the use of chemicals, high voltages, or long exposure times. | 2015-08-27 |

20150238659 | BIOPROSTHETIC TISSUE WITH REDUCED CALCIFICATION - A treatment for bioprosthetic tissue used in implants or for assembled bioprosthetic heart valves to reduce in vivo calcification. The method includes applying a calcification mitigant such as a capping agent or an antioxidant to the tissue to specifically inhibit oxidation in tissue. Also, the method can be used to inhibit oxidation in dehydrated tissue. The capping agent suppresses the formation of binding sites in the tissue that are exposed or generated by the oxidation and otherwise would, upon implant, attract calcium, phosphate, immunogenic factors, or other precursors to calcification. In one method, tissue leaflets in assembled bioprosthetic heart valves are pretreated with an aldehyde capping agent prior to dehydration and sterilization. | 2015-08-27 |

20150238672 | SELF CALIBRATING BLOOD CHAMBER - An optical blood monitoring system and corresponding method avoid the need to obtain a precise intensity value of the light impinging upon the measured blood layer during the analysis. The system is operated to determine at least two optical measurements through blood layers of different thickness but otherwise substantially identical systems. Due to the equivalence of the systems, the two measurements can be compared so that the bulk extinction coefficient of the blood can be calculated based only on the known blood layer thicknesses and the two measurements. Reliable measurements of various blood parameters can thereby be determined without certain calibration steps. | 2015-08-27 |

20150238676 | PORTABLE HEMODIALYSIS MACHINE AND DISPOSABLE CARTRIDGE - A portable hemodialysis system is provided including a disposable cartridge and a reused dialysis machine. The disposable cartridge includes a dialyzer, and a dialysate flow path and a blood flow path which flow in opposing directions through the dialyzer. The disposable cartridge includes a filter for removing waste products from the dialysate, and pressure and fluid flow sensors for measuring the pressure and fluid flow in the dialysate flow path and blood flow path. In addition, the disposable cartridge possesses pump actuators (but not pump motors) for pumping dialysate and blood through their respective flow paths. The reused dialysis machine possesses a reservoir for dialysate, a level sensor, a blood leak sensor, an ammonia sensor, a venous blood line pressure sensor, a venous blood line bubble detector, pump motors, and a processor connected to the motors and sensors for controlling and monitoring hemodialysis treatment. | 2015-08-27 |
